Game Recap: Men's Basketball |

Mayville Knocks Off Cougars

MORRIS, Minn. – Minnesota Morris (1-8) was unable to hold a six point halftime lead, falling 77-72 in overtime to Mayville State (7-3). Four Cougars scored in double-figures on the night, led by RJ Dean's 14 points. Cody Emrick and Tyler Ukkelburg each added 13; it was a new career high for Ukkelburg. Neil Helgeson added 11 points.
 
The Cougars defense kept them in the game all night forcing 20 turnovers which helped them overcome a 24-66 shooting night. Joe Roggenbuck led the team with nine rebounds. Ukkelburg was second on the team with seven rebounds.
 
The game was extremely tight throughout a majority of the first half. The lead changed hands seven times in the first twenty minutes alone. Morris was hot in the first half from three, hitting 57% from behind the arc. Mayville State led 26-22 with 3:32 left in the first half but UMM finished the half on a 12-2 run, capped off by a jumper from Dean as time expired.
 
Morris would hold on to their lead as the second half got underway and even pushed it to as much as nine with 14:48 left. The Comets would claw their way back, eventually taking a one point lead with 8:35 left in the game. The lead would change hands a few more times and no team led by more than three the rest of the second half. Minnesota Morris had a crack at the last shot in regulation with the game tied at 66 but the shot was blocked and the game headed into overtime.
 
Both the Cougars and Comets hit their first two shots in the extra session and the game was tied at 70 midway through overtime. Mayville State pushed their lead to four with 21 seconds left and held off Morris the rest of the way.
 
Up next for the Cougars is a trip to Valley City State next Friday night at 7:30 p.m. Morris will not return home until January 10 when they take on Crown in the UMAC conference opener.
